Huo Xing Cai Jing reports, according to CNBC, that Situational Awareness, an AI-themed hedge fund founded by former OpenAI researcher Leopold Aschenbrenner, sold its entire public equity portfolio in a single transaction to another hedge fund prior to Thursday’s market open; the buyer has not been disclosed. The fund also sold a significant portion of its stake in Anthropic. With assets under management of approximately $20 billion to $24 billion, the fund achieved a net return of 439% as of the end of June, making it one of the top-performing hedge funds this year. According to sources familiar with the matter, the liquidation followed substantial losses in recent weeks. The fund held long positions in AI infrastructure and semiconductor stocks such as SK Hynix, NVIDIA, Micron, and CoreWeave, most of which declined more than 35% this month. Meanwhile, its short positions in software stocks like Adobe also moved sharply against it. According to its March 31 13F filing, approximately 62% of its $13.68 billion portfolio consisted of put options betting on declines in semiconductor and technology stocks. It is reported that major prime brokers including Bank of America, Goldman Sachs, and JPMorgan are assisting the fund in meeting margin calls or facilitating an orderly wind-down. Aschenbrenner has approached existing investors and lenders for new capital.
